At 0359, Station 21 was alerted to 4665 Freys Lane for a residential structure fire.  Chief 21 was on scene with a working fire in an uninhabited house, calling for a defensive attack.  Engine 21 arrived and pulled a 3" supply line for two handlines, the Blitzfire portable monitor, and a 3" handline.  Engine 41 arrived with additional personnel and handled the portable pond from Tanker 21.  A tanker shuttle from a hydrant at the corner of Campbell Road and Old Orchard Road was utilized to supply water to the fireground.  The fire was marked under control at 0445 and units cleared the scene at 0758.
